Mindfulness: Your Connection Remedy
In the age where many are grappling with feelings of loneliness, mindfully engaging with our surroundings and the people in them is essential. Studies, like those conducted by the Carnegie Mellon University and the Mind & Life Institute, highlight that individuals who practice mindfulness report feeling less lonely and more satisfied in their social connections. By being present, we allow ourselves to engage in deeper conversations that nurture our relationships.
Strategies for Mindful Living
Incorporating mindful practices into your daily routine can significantly enhance your emotional well-being. Consider these actionable mindfulness exercises:
- Mindful Breathing: Spend a few minutes focusing solely on your breath. This can ground you in the present moment and help dissipate anxiety.
- Body Scan Meditation: This practice encourages introspection by inviting you to pay attention to each part of your body, fostering a connection between your body and mind.
- Heart-Centered Listening: While interacting with others, practice deep listening by attending to their words and emotions with intention, creating an atmosphere of trust and understanding.
